Chris Brown beating: verified context, legal outcomes, and career impact

What happened and why this topic persists in public discussion

In the early morning of February 8, 2009, an altercation between Chris Brown and then-girlfriend Rihanna inside a leased Lamborghini in Los Angeles led to widespread media attention and legal consequences. This verified explainer outlines the key facts from the incident and investigation, through criminal charges and probation, to restraining orders and later court events, while focusing on how the episode reshaped his public image and professional trajectory. Details are drawn from court records, law enforcement reports, and credible news documentation.

Key timeline and factual overview

Understanding the sequence helps separate legal outcomes from speculation. Below is a concise, evidence-anchored timeline drawing on court filings and official statements.

Date or Period Event Why It Matters
February 8, 2009, early morning Reported physical altercation in a Lamborghini in Los Angeles; Rihanna injured Established the factual basis for criminal charges
February 2009 Arrest and booking on felony domestic violence charges Triggered public and legal processes
June 2009 Guilty plea to felony assault with a deadly weapon Marked a resolved judicial outcome with defined penalties
August 2009 Sentencing: five years probation, domestic violence counseling, community service Illustrates the judicial remedy and conditions imposed
2013–2014 Multiple probation violations reported; brief jail stays Shows ongoing legal supervision and consequences
2016 Rihanna obtained and later had extended restraining orders renewed Highlights continuing legal protections and boundaries

The judicial response to the incident was multi-stage, involving charges, a plea, and structured sentencing. No single fact pattern tells the full story without citing the formal outcomes that followed.

  • Initial charge: Felony assault with a deadly weapon, based on allegations of striking Rihanna with an ashtray
  • Plea agreement: Entered a guilty plea to one count of felony assault with a deadly weapon
  • Sentence terms: Five years of probation, domestic violence intervention program, and community service
  • Restraining orders: Multiple civil restraining orders, most notably in 2016, with specific conditions and renewal proceedings
  • Probation history: Documented violations in 2013 and 2014 resulting in short custody periods

Impact on professional career and industry response

The incident and its legal aftermath influenced bookings, partnerships, and public reception. This section focuses on verifiable changes and trends observed by critics and industry observers.

  • Early career disruption: Concert cancellations and delays in project rollouts in 2009
  • Gradual rebooking: Return to touring and recording, with mixed reception at first and growing audiences over time
  • Brand and partnership shifts: Some brands paused collaboration; others resumed engagement as public narrative evolved
  • Streaming and catalog performance: Continued commercial interest in his catalog, though sometimes complicated by controversy
  • Public statements: Occasional interviews addressing the incident, accountability, and personal growth
